Ответ:
The 99% confidence interval is be given by (4.872;8.628)
Step-by-step explanation:
A confidence interval is "a range of values that’s likely to include a population value with a certain degree of confidence. It is often expressed a % whereby a population means lies between an upper and lower interval".
The margin of error is the range of values below and above the sample statistic in a confidence interval.
Normal distribution, is a "probability distribution that is symmetric about the mean, showing that data near the mean are more frequent in occurrence than data far from the mean".
The dataset is:
6, 9, 3, 9, 6, 6, 7, 7, 8, 9, 3, 8
2) Compute the sample mean and sample standard deviation.
In order to calculate the mean and the sample deviation we need to have on mind the following formulas:
The value obtained is![\bar X=6.75](/tpl/images/0395/7571/3131e.png)
The sample deviation obtained is![s=2.094](/tpl/images/0395/7571/249e4.png)
3) Find the critical value t* Use the formula for a CI to find upper and lower endpoints
In order to find the critical value we need to take in count that our sample size n =12 <30 and on this case we don't know about the population standard deviation, so on this case we need to use the t distribution. Since our interval is at 99% of confidence, our significance level would be given by
